The d20 technique is a role-taking part in video game system released in 2000 by Wizards on the Coastline, originally produced to the 3rd edition of Dungeons & Dragons.[1] The program is named once the 20-sided dice that happen to be central to the core mechanics of many steps in the sport.
mainly because Dungeons and Dragons is the most well-liked purpose-actively playing activity in the world, a lot of 3rd party publishers develop products meant to be suitable with that recreation and its cousin, d20 fashionable. Wizards in the Coastline provides a independent license letting publishers to use several of its trademarked terms and a distinctive emblem to help you individuals discover these goods. This is known as the d20 process Trademark License. The d20 process Trademark License (D20STL) necessitates publishers to exclude character creation and progression rules, implement selected notices and adhere to a suitable content material policy.

The program reference document under the open up sport license as open up sport written content, which permits professional & non-industrial publishers to launch modifications on the program devoid of purchasing the use of the procedure connected to mental assets.
[five]: 293 Between both of these crises, quite a few d20 publishers went outside of small business or remaining the sphere, but most that remained absolutely deserted the d20 trademark in favor of publishing underneath the OGL. Publishers understood that they could publish d20 online games correctly devoid of dependent upon the core textbooks from Wizards in the Coastline, and publishers even started to generate OGL-dependent games which were immediate competitors to D&D.[5]: 293
